在现代软件开发中,效率至关重要。尤其是在使用像Tokenim这样的工具进行应用程序打包时,打包速度的慢不仅会影响开发者的工作效率,还可能延误项目的发布时间。如果你在使用Tokenim时发现打包速度较慢,本文将为你提供一系列建议和解决方案,帮助你提高打包效率。
在深入探讨打包慢的问题之前,让我们简单了解一下Tokenim。Tokenim是一种现代的开发工具,旨在简化应用程序的构建和打包过程。它支持多种编程语言和框架,便于开发者在不同环境中进行应用部署。尽管Tokenim在许多方面表现良好,但打包性能问题仍然是许多用户提出的一个主要 complaint。
在解决打包慢的问题之前,首先要深入了解打包慢的原因。通常,打包速度慢可能由以下几个因素引起:
接下来,我们将提供一些有效的策略,帮助你提高Tokenim的打包速度,解决打包慢的问题。
保持项目结构的简洁与有效,可以显著提高打包效率。确保只包含必要的文件和资源,避免冗余文件的打包。
确保你的Tokenim配置文件是的。仔细审查并消除不必要的配置项,使用预设配置可以提高整体打包速度。
尽量减少项目中的依赖包数量。使用小型、轻量的库,避免一些过大或功能完全的依赖,以减少打包时间的延迟。
如果硬件条件有限,可以考虑将打包任务迁移到云服务上,利用云计算的强大处理能力来提升打包速度。
研究和使用脚本自动化打包过程,定期清理无用文件和版本,避免不必要的资源浪费。
在选择硬件时,基本的考虑因素包括处理器(CPU)、内存(RAM)和存储设备(SSD vs HDD)。一个强劲的中央处理器能够更快地执行打包任务。推荐至少使用四核处理器,并确保拥有足够的RAM(至少8GB)。存储设备方面,SSD相比HDD通常具有更快的读取和写入速度,这直接影响打包时间。
依赖管理的关键在于理解每个依赖的必要性。建议使用工具,如npm、Yarn等,定期更新、审查项目中的依赖,确保你只保留必需的库。此外,你还可以在打包配置中使用“tree-shaking”功能,自动剔除未被使用的依赖,进一步提高打包效率。
可以使用工具,如Webpack Bundle Analyzer,来对打包过程进行监控和分析。这样可以可视化打包过程中每个资源所占用的时间,从而识别性能瓶颈。在找到瓶颈后,可以逐一相应的部分,来提高整体打包速度。
在多开发者环境中,可以利用CI/CD工具(如Jenkins、GitHub Actions等)来实现代码的持续集成和自动化打包。通过创建统一的打包规范,确保每个开发者的环境与配置一致,以防止版本和环境差异影响打包速度。
在使用Tokenim工具进行打包时,虽然打包速度慢是一个常见问题,但通过项目结构、配置、依赖管理以及硬件资源,可以有效提升打包效率。希望本文提供的策略和解决方案能够帮助你在未来的项目中更加高效地使用Tokenim,提升工作效率,实现更好的成果。
随着技术的不断进步,我们也期待Tokenim在打包性能上的改进,希望每位开发者都能够享受到高效与便捷的开发体验。